Transaction Detail

txid58ab46a21c068e0719768d8119f02566a4abf2308d0de218b5a212f67566d5b8
Block Hash3e81d5908fea9db9bb30b9f1077b2f4556a79c7fdcfdb8ec3b0d1bd4cc05fe71
Time2017-10-12 05:05:26 UTC
Version1
Confirmations9113231

Transaction

InputOutput
coinbase:
038d21060104062f503253482f